In Spain and Germany a so-called constructive, or positive, vote of no confidence is required to remove a government, whereby members of the legislature can generally oust a government from office only if they simultaneously agree on a replacement; for example, in 1982 Helmut Kohl was selected as Germanys chancellor only after the Bundestag had ousted his predecessor, Helmut Schmidt, and agreed to elect Kohl as his replacement. Our concerns about the management of Temple were never about one person but about the way those in senior leadership have failed over the past several years to live up to Temples mission as Philadelphias public research university, Jeffrey Doshna, president of TAUP, said at a 1 p.m. news conference on campus, where he announced that 825 of 1,030 faculty had voted in favor of no confidence. Faculty began discussing the possibility of taking a no-confidence vote in university leadership as the graduate student strike, which began Jan. 31, dragged on and concerns about safety mounted after Fitzgeralds Feb. 18 death.
